CAMEL UNIT

CAMEL UNIT is a Texas gas lease in Washington County, Railroad Commission district 03, operated by Rme Petroleum Company. It has 1 wellbore on file with the Commission. Reported production runs from October 2001 to August 2026, totalling 1,294,284 thousand cubic feet. The lease is not currently producing. Its strongest month on the record we hold was August 2018, at 5,758 thousand cubic feet.
